RE: @PagedOut@infosec.exchange
This article (recommended if you're learning RE!) reminded me of a GOATed FPGA bistream reversing task from Google CTF (GPURTL by Robin), where the key to solving it for me was observing the pattern of changing bits in FPGA's registers. The pattern itself was enough to pinpont the exact algorithm.
@liveoverflow@bird.makeup made a video about this task: https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=3ac9HAsfV8c

My second article in Paged Out! #8 was about the architecture of the terminal emulator on Linux - it's a really obvious thing until you start digging into details, as usual.
Web viewer: https://pagedout.institute/webview.php?issue=8&page=43&article=Linux+terminal+emulator+architecture
PDF download: https://pagedout.institute/?page=issues.php
